Decorative framed emblem featuring the traditional Freemasonry Square and Compasses surrounding the All-Seeing Eye (an eye within a glowing triangle or radiant glory)
*The Square and Compasses: This is the most universally recognized symbol of Freemasonry. The Square symbolizes morality, honesty, and treating others fairly ("square dealing"). The Compasses symbolize the boundaries of good behavior, virtue, and keeping passions in check.
* Placed in the center, this is a traditional Masonic symbol representing the Great Architect of the Universe (a common term for a supreme being) and serves as a reminder that a person's thoughts and deeds are always observed.

*Masonic medals (or "jewels") symbolize membership, rank, achievement, and commemoration, featuring common symbols like the Square & Compasses (morality), All-Seeing Eye (divine watchfulness), Beehive (industry), or Anchor (hope/immortality) to denote a Mason's journey, service, or specific accomplishments within the fraternity, acting as outward reminders of their dedication and progress.
**Membership Medals: Often feature core symbols like the Square & Compasses, signifying belonging to the Craft.
**Rank & Office Medals: Indicate a Mason's office (e.g., Past Master's Jewel) or degree, sometimes with specific designs like Euclid's 47th Proposition for Past Masters.
**Charity Jewels: Awarded for significant donations, serving as a reminder of philanthropic giving.
**Commemorative Medals: Struck to mark specific events, anniversaries, or installations, similar to coins but with deeper symbolic meaning.
